    • — Chevy Monte Carlo: 396 wins. The Monte Carlo has almost twice as many wins as the second-place car in Cup. If it was racing, it would have lapped the field twice.
    • — Ford Galaxie (with a couple Thunderbirds): 199 Wins. Fred Lorenzen, Ned Jarrett and Dan Gurney all raced Galaxies to victory, with setups done by Holman & Moody as well as by-then-car-owner Junior Johnson.
    • — Ford Thunderbird (with some Mercury Cougars): 184 Wins. From 1978 to 1987 Ford Thunderbirds were a force to reckon with in NASCAR. Aerodynamically efficient and still powerful, they were fast and stable on the high banks.
